Below is a list of best universities in Australia ranked based on their research performance in Environmental Chemistry. A graph of 2.3M citations received by 56.9K academic papers made by 36 universities in Australia was used to calculate publications' ratings, which then were adjusted for release dates and added to final scores.

We don't distinguish between undergraduate and graduate programs nor do we adjust for current majors offered. You can find information about granted degrees on a university page but always double-check with the university website.
